Can you put 70 isopropyl alcohol in spray bottle?
You can mix up a quick defrosting solution by combining one part water and two parts 70 percent rubbing alcohol in a spray bottle. Spraying this on the windshield will make the frost easier to remove.Jul 8, 2019
How long does isopropyl alcohol last in a spray bottle?
Depending on the manufacturer, the expiration date can be 2 to 3 years from the date it was manufactured. Rubbing alcohol expires because isopropanol evaporates when exposed to the air, while the water remains.

Why is 70 isopropyl alcohol used as a disinfectant?
70% isopropyl alcohol kills organisms by denaturing their proteins and dissolving their lipids and is effective against most bacteria, fungi and many viruses, but is ineffective against bacterial spores (CDC, 2020).
How can rubbing alcohol be used as a disinfectant?
Don't dilute rubbing alcohol with water. First, wash the surface you wish to disinfect with soap and water. Then use a wipe, towel, or spray bottle to evenly apply the rubbing alcohol to the surface. Let it sit for at least 30 seconds.Aug 20, 2020
Is isopropyl alcohol a sanitizer?
A: Hand sanitizers labeled as containing the term “alcohol,” used by itself, are expected to contain ethanol (also known as ethyl alcohol). Only two alcohols are permitted as active ingredients in alcohol-based hand sanitizers – ethanol (ethyl alcohol) or isopropyl alcohol (isopropanol or 2-propanol).Nov 2, 2021

How much water do I mix with isopropyl alcohol?
TO MAKE A STANDARD SOLUTION (70%):
Dilute by adding 1 part water to 2 parts of this 99% Isopropyl Alcohol.

What happens when you mix water and rubbing alcohol?
When you mix the rubbing alcohol with water, the latter's molecules make hydrogen bonds with the water molecules. The alcohol dissolves in the water to form a homogenous solution, so you cannot distinguish the alcohol and the water anymore.Nov 9, 2017

What is the recommended use for 70 isopropyl alcohol?
70% isopropyl alcohol is most commonly used disinfectant in pharmaceutical industries. The important thing is that only 70% solution of isopropyl alcohol acts as a disinfectant killing all surface microorganisms. It is used to disinfect hands and equipment surface in pharmaceuticals.

How do I make 70 IPA?
4 Take IPA and water in 70:30 ratio for example for the preparation of 3 liters of IPA take 0.900 Liters of Purified Water (use fresh purified water) in a Clean Stainless Steel Container and Add 2.100 liters of Isopropyl Alcohol.Jul 13, 2020

What is 99 percent isopropyl alcohol?
- ISOPROPYL ALCOHOL 99%. Isopropyl alcohol is a fast-evaporating solvent and industrial cleaning agent, intended for industrial or professional use only. It can be used as a solvent for gums, shellac, and essential oils. Can be used as a fuel additive.

Is isopropyl alcohol an antiseptic?
- Isopropanol , which is another name for isopropyl alcohol, can be used as an antiseptic, a solvent or a cleaning agent. It is important to exercise caution when using isopropyl alcohol, since it is flammable and can cause adverse effects on your health if used improperly or ingested.
